Web13 feb. 2024 · Definition 11.6. 1. A system of nonlinear equations is a system where at least one of the equations is not linear. Just as with systems of linear equations, a solution of a nonlinear system is an ordered pair that makes both equations true. In a nonlinear system, there may be more than one solution.
